It traditionally roams fields, hedgerows, forests and grass lands where it can find plenty of food. The Wood Mouse will live just about anywhere there is food and shelter. They grow to about 10cm long and weigh 30 grams or so full grown.

It does however provide a vital food source for many of the UK’s carnivorous creatures as well as being a major pest.Īs shown in the above picture, they have a dark brown fur with enormous eyes and ears for their size.

The true field mouse is the Long Tailed Field Mouse, or Wood Mouse and it is one of our most endearing / or terrifying animals depending on your point of view. The Field Mouse is a generic term for a range of mice in the UK.
